(Judgment of the Court was made by HULUVADI G.RAMESH, J.) Heard the learned counsel for the appellant and the learned Special Government Pleader for the respondents.

2. It appears that an option has been given by the learned single Judge to the appellant/writ petitioner to move the Government by filing review. However, even without exhausting the said remedy, the appellant has approached this Court in all https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/

hurry. Though it is the case of the appellant that the witnesses have not spoken to about certain things, the fact remains that it is a case of having illegal nexus with the bootleggers and there is semblance of evidence on record. It is for this reason the appellant/writ petitioner has been compulsorily retired.

3. In our considered opinion, when the learned single Judge has given liberty to the appellant/writ petitioner to move the Government by filing review, as contemplated under Rule 5-A of the Tamil Nadu Police Subordinate Service (Discipline & Appeal) Rules, 1955, the said exercise has not been done. In these circumstances, we give liberty to the appellant to do the needful by filing review before the Government, both on merits as well on the quantum of punishment, within a period of one month from the date of receipt of a copy of this order, and it is for the Government to consider the same on merits and shall pass appropriate orders in accordance with law within a period of two months from the date of receipt of such representation/review from the appellant/writ petitioner. With this observation, the writ appeal stands disposed of. No costs. Sd/- Assistant Registrar(CCC) //True Copy// Sub Assistant Registrar ss To
